        Back to your questions: I don't know of any brand of absorption refrigerator that does not have issues. At least those of any size. The small absorption fridges in Class B and Class C rigs seem fine, or even larger ones that are NOT installed in a slide. My personal experience is with a Dometic RM1350 that I eventually gave up on. My wife loves the Haier residential that is now in our camper.

        While I understand that a residential or 12vDC may seem "non-boondocker friendly", with a reasonable LifePO4 battery bank and a fast charger, a small inverter generator (like the Champion I carry with me) can recharge the bank relatively quickly. So much so that water (and dumping waste) will be the limiting factor when it comes to boondocking, not power.
